Hi all.
Two queries return same result. The first one always takes about 7ms,
the second 1.5ms.

Query 1:
-------------------------
select
c2c.position, c2c.category, c.*
from categories_companies c2c
join companies c on c2c.company = c.id
where c2c.category ~ 'otdelka_i_remont.*'::lquery
order by c2c.position, c.id
limit 20 offset 1760;
-------------------------

Query 2:
-------------------------
with cte as (
select c2c.position, c2c.company, c2c.category
from categories_companies c2c
where c2c.category ~ 'otdelka_i_remont.*'::lquery
order by c2c.position, c2c.company, c2c.category
limit 20 offset 1760
)
select c2c.position, c2c.category, c.*
from cte c2c
join companies c on c2c.company = c.id;
-------------------------

Indexes:
- categories_companies.category (c2c.category) is of type ltree, indexed
by both gist and btree
- categories_companies (c2c) have composite PK of company and category
- companies.id (c.id) is PK, no explicit indexes created

Questions:
1. Is this is normal, or I done something incorrectly?
2. What can I do to make first query perform as fast as the second one?

What I tried:
Removing order by clause (though I do need that ordering) does not helps.
Putting "category ~ 'otdelka_i_remont.*'" to ON block of JOIN clause
does not make difference.
